Meet Debbie Organ

The founder of Integrity Corporate Finance Group and the woman you want on your side of the negotiating table.

Debbie established Integrity Corporate Finance Group in 1997 with one clear mission: to eradicate the unethical practices that were plaguing the financial services industry.

Dubbed as ‘the Erin Brockovich of the finance and business community, Debbie built her reputation on protecting her clients from unethical contracts, in the process saving them millions of dollars.

Advice you can trust

With a 30-year executive management career in banking and finance, Debbie knows the inner workings of the banking system better than anyone else.

For the past 20 years, she has passionately campaigned for industry regulation and has negotiated on behalf of hundreds of clients across Australia.

Our Clients

Integrity Corporate Finance Group clients include major universities, FMCG brands, councils and government departments as well over

300 licensed clubs and hotels and various not-for-profit groups.

Debbie has been a trusted and long-standing tender manager and advisor to Marrickville council and Tweed Shire Council since

the early 2000’s and delivered a procurement tender of $66.8 million for the Ballina Shire Council Wastewater Upgrade.

Speaking and Facilitation

Debbie is a highly sought after conference speaker and workshop facilitator on the topics of ethical business practices, demystifying finance for business and her personal story of climbing the ladder in the male-dominated banking industry of the 1980s and 90s.

Debbie is also a long-standing advocate and fund-raiser for the disadvantaged, a recipient of the Pride of Australia Award, and a three-time nominee for Business Woman of the Year.
